Output 97315634ec08ab1a0636b4f5aeb2e5fdd942ea799ae67bcf80b3d7902bff580c:5

value
2420916
script pubkey
OP_0 OP_PUSHBYTES_20 abcb134b83d862925c3ad126b762dcff013b067d
address
bc1q4093xjurmp3fyhp66yntwckuluqnkpna52fm20
transaction
97315634ec08ab1a0636b4f5aeb2e5fdd942ea799ae67bcf80b3d7902bff580c
confirmations
196028
spent
true